Greenbrier Village Residential Living offers competitive pricing for its studio units at $2,735 per month, making it an appealing option for those seeking affordable residential living. When compared to the average costs in Garfield County and across Oklahoma, which stand at $3,665 and $3,629 respectively, Greenbrier emerges as a more budget-friendly choice. This difference highlights Greenbrier's commitment to providing quality living arrangements while maintaining affordability, allowing residents to enjoy a comfortable lifestyle without stretching their financial resources.
Room Type | Greenbrier Village Residential Living | Garfield County | Oklahoma |
---|---|---|---|
Studio | $2,735 | $3,665 | $3,629 |
Greenbrier Village Residential Living in Enid, OK is a premier assisted living community offering a range of care services and amenities to enhance the quality of life for its residents. With both Independent Living and Memory Care options available, Greenbrier Village is dedicated to providing personalized care and support for individuals at various stages of their lives.
Residents enjoy a comfortable and spacious living environment with air-conditioning, fully furnished rooms, private bathrooms, and access to outdoor spaces such as gardens. The community also offers a variety of amenities including a beauty salon, fitness room, gaming room, small library, wellness center, and Wi-Fi/high-speed internet access.
At Greenbrier Village, residents can expect exceptional care services provided by trained staff members available 24/7. Assistance with activities of daily living such as bathing, dressing, and transfers is readily available. The community also offers diabetes care and specialized memory care programming for those with cognitive impairments. Medication management ensures that residents receive the appropriate medications on time.
Dining at Greenbrier Village is a delightful experience with restaurant-style dining and meals provided. Special dietary restrictions are accommodated to ensure that all residents receive nutritious meals that meet their individual needs.
Engaging in social activities and staying active is encouraged at Greenbrier Village. Community-sponsored activities, resident-run activities, fitness programs, planned day trips, and scheduled daily activities provide opportunities for socialization and entertainment. Devotional services off-site cater to spiritual needs as well.
Conveniently located near two cafes and a variety of other amenities including parks, pharmacies, physicians' offices, restaurants, transportation options, and places of worship ensure that residents have easy access to essential services within the local community.
